Honoring our longstanding traditions, Kossuth Square will once again host a ceremonial military tribute as the Hungarian national flag is raised, followed by the public oath-taking ceremony of the newly graduated officer cadets of the Nemzeti Közszolgálati Egyetem (National University of Public Service), which visitors can watch on August 20. Following the flag-raising and officer commissioning, the military air show hugely popular in recent years, will take place over the Danube, viewable from both the Pest and Buda embankments.

In the evening, the whole nation can celebrate together at Kossuth Square at the large-scale party called Diszkótér(Disco Square). In front of the Parliament building, popular current hits will play alongside well-known songs from past decades on the evening of August 20, so that every generation can find their favorite tunes.

A special visual highlight of the event is the light projection on the Hungarian Parliament Building, making the festive evening even more memorable. Surrounded by lights and music in this historic setting, the square in front of Parliament becomes, for one evening, a shared dance floor for the whole country, where everyone can experience togetherness and joyful, shared celebration.

In addition, on August 20, the day marking the foundation of the Hungarian state, the Hungarian Parliament Building will open its doors to the public free of charge and without prior registration as part of the Nyitott Parlament (Open Parliament) programme. On this day, visitors can admire the building's stunning interior spaces up close, including the Díszlépcsőház (Grand Staircase) and the Kupolacsarnok (Dome Hall).

Accessibility

Following the officer commissioning ceremony, an accessible area will be set up on the south side of the Parliament building near the Andrássy statue, separated from the crowd, and will remain accessible throughout the evening. Accessible restrooms are also available. The Open Parliament programme can be visited by people with reduced mobility without waiting in line: please contact the Parliamentary Guard for assistance!
